Cool, Dry Season
A period in some climates characterized by lower temperatures and minimal precipitation, often occurring in the winter or the dry season in tropical regions.
Temperate Rain Forest
A biome located in temperate regions characterized by consistent rainfall throughout the year, resulting in lush, dense forests with a diverse array of plant and animal life.
Coniferous Forest
A type of biome characterized by evergreen trees that have needles and produce cones, typically found in northern latitudes.
